SALT LAKE CITY, UT – Former Oregon State head coach Gary Andersen has found a landing spot after leaving his job with the Beavers’ football team in October. Andersen was announced as an assistant head coach and defensive assistant for the Utah Utes Tuesday morning. A former player and coach at Utah, Andersen will join Kyle Whittingham’s staff for a second time.
Andersen previously coached at Utah under Whittingham from 2005-08, serving as defensive coordinator, assistant head coach, and defensive line coach. He spent two-and-a-half seasons with the Beavers and compiled a 7-23 record. Andersen only coached the first six games in 2017 before coming to a mutual agreement with the university to part ways.
